Marshall Mathers, Eminem – the rapper of legendary repute – went onto Instagram to thank all his ardent fans for having graced the premiere of his new film ‘Stans.’ The rapper shared some moments in a group photo. Thanking all attendees and collaborators like Dr. Dre and Snoop Dogg, the post instantly generated a flood of reactions from fans worldwide. Many shared their experiences in watching the film; one called it “like therapy in a cinema” and really enjoyed the “behind the scenes of Eminem.” A funny comment was left on one of the pictures about “a very tight hug, hostage situation,” which was followed by another wave of hilarious responses. A few even claimed there was genuine fear in Eminem’s eyes, while others said it was pure enthusiasm.
It was a life-changing experience for some attendees. One called it “the best day of my life”; another had just stepped out of the theater also felt awestruck as the film had opened up a whole new perspective about the artist: “You have been my inspiration and my support since I was a teenager,” another very emotional comment came from a person from Mexico. Most such comments had a similar feeling affirming that the movie increased their respect for Eminem and the influence of his music on their kids’ lives.
The international response came as strong at the Greek fans acknowledging that they were not alone in their country to love that rapper. Meanwhile, Spanish-speaking fans literally begged for any news of a concert for Mexico, jokingly demanding a “button” to shut it up.
Not all comments, though, were lighthearted. One user questioned the need for plastic surgeries and advised Eminem to “age gracefully.” But most of the conversation was laden with appreciation and spectacle of calling him a “beautiful human.”
The ‘Stans’ documentary – the movie about the sort of mad devotion that defines Eminem’s fan base – has succeeded in touching hearts.
